What do I need to purchase a long gun?

To purchase a long gun in Iowa, you will need to be at least 18 years old. You will need government issued picture identification to confirm identity and government issued identification/documentation that confirms your current address. A valid drivers license with your current address will satisfy both requirements.

What do I need to purchase a handgun?

To purchase a handgun in Iowa, you will need to be at least 21 years old and be an Iowa resident.  You will need government issued picture identification to confirm identity and government issued identification/documentation that confirms your current address and Iowa residency. A valid Iowa Driver License with your current address will satisfy the photo identification, current address, and Iowa residency requirements.

Where do I apply for an Iowa Permit to Acquire or an Iowa Permit to Carry?

To apply for either an Iowa Permit to Acquire or an Iowa Permit to Carry, you must go to the Sheriff’s Office in the county which you reside. You will be required to fill out some paperwork to facilitate a background check, show valid government identification to confirm your identity, and show proof of your current address. The Iowa Permit to Acquire generally costs $20 and the Iowa Permit to Carry Weapons generally costs $55. Many Sheriff departments only accept cash.

I have a permit. Do I still need to fill out the paperwork to purchase a firearm?

Yes. All customers must complete a Form 4473 prior to purchasing any firearm. The Iowa Permit to Acquire or the Iowa Permit to Carry is an exemption from conducting a FBI NICS check, but is not an exemption from completing a Form 4473.
